New Books–January 2016
Complete New Book List January 2016 God’s Glory Alone–The Majestic Heart of Christian Faith and Life: What the Reformers Taught… and Why It Still Matters, by David VanDrunen (The Five Solas series). Second in the series on the five solas of the Protestant Reformation. The Great Divide–New Book in the Library
Library Note: I recently completed this magnificent book about the animosity between Washington and Jefferson, former friends and founding fathers who became adversaries due to different visions for the new nation. The divergence between their visions is ultimately seen in the later dissolution of the union that resulted in the Civil War.
